Q1 2026 overview

What this importer's trade footprint looks like

Corporacion Oceanica El Salvador processed 56 shipments across 5 suppliers and 4 countries in Q1 2026. The Dominican Republic was the primary source, accounting for 21% of shipments, with Lexzau Scharbau as the leading supplier at 12 shipments. The importer's product mix was dominated by HS Chapter 48 (paper and paperboard products), representing the largest commodity category. Additional sourcing included ceramic construction materials and miscellaneous manufacturing inputs across seven distinct HS codes.

Methodology. Snapshot built from US Customs AMS import and export bill-of-lading records arrived between Q1 2026 (Jan – Mar). Supplier risk score is a composite of activity, diversification, stability, recency, forwarder-cleanness, HS consistency, sanctions screen, and forced-labor proximity. Sanctions screen runs trigram similarity against the OpenSanctions FTM corpus (4.2M+ records, 32,982 sanctioned entities, 91,894 names + aliases). Forced-labor proximity is a haversine distance from each CN supplier's resolved coordinate to the nearest of 380 documented facilities in the ASPI Xinjiang Data Project.
